Police arrest three rape accused, emphasizing stern action against crimes against women
9/29/2023 9:42:32 PM
Early Times Report
JAMMU, Sept 29: In a resolute move to combat crimes against women, the Samba Police, under the unwavering guidance of Senior Superintendent of Police (SSP) Benam Tosh, have successfully apprehended three rape suspects within the jurisdiction of the Samba Police Station.
The individuals in custody have been identified as Rohit Kumar, a resident of Arnia in district Jammu; Rohit Saini, also from Arnia, district Jammu; and Romi Kumar, hailing from Samba. The commendable efforts that led to these arrests were spearheaded by SHO (Station House Officer) Daljit Singh of the Samba Police Station, operating under the vigilant supervision of Deputy Superintendent of Police (DySP) Garu Ram and Additional SP Samba Surinder Choudhary.
This crucial operation was conducted in strict accordance with the directives of SSP Benam Tosh, who has made it a top priority to address and combat crimes against women in the Samba district. The police have undertaken sensitive investigations into cases related to crimes against women, with a particular focus on those involving allegations of rape, molestation, domestic violence, and assault. Those individuals found to be involved in such heinous acts and subsequently proven guilty by the diligent work of the police force are being arrested and brought to justice under the prevailing laws.
